Operational Maturity and Track Record: Daytraders has been operating for three years and maintains a perfect 10.0/10 AI score across all dimensions, with consistently positive feedback regarding fast payouts, responsive support, and straightforward trading conditions. YRM Prop, founded in 2025 with only one year of operation, shows a 4.0/10 overall score with significant concerns around payout processing delays lasting weeks to months and inconsistent customer support responsiveness. This substantial difference reflects different levels of operational stability and execution reliability.
Cost and Account Flexibility: YRM Prop offers a lower entry barrier with its 40% discount (bringing accounts to approximately $32.40 at lowest), whereas Daytraders' base account starts at $24.50. YRM Prop also provides more diverse payout methods (Rise, Wire, ACH, Crypto) compared to Daytraders' single payout option. However, Daytraders allows up to 15 funded accounts while YRM Prop caps at 3, which may appeal differently depending on trading strategy and scaling preferences.
Technology and Risk Assessment: Both firms support futures trading and offer legitimate platforms, though with different selections. YRM Prop receives a 10/10 technology score and maintains reasonable trading rules (6/10), but these strengths are significantly undermined by the reported payout and support failures. Daytraders presents a more balanced profile where technical infrastructure, support systems, and payment processing appear aligned and functional. For traders prioritizing payment reliability and support responsiveness, Daytraders presents substantially lower operational risk.
